In the centre of the square is the town’s oldest fountain, adorned with a statue representing justice. Close by, a clock presents the history of Vaud in animated scenes every hour from 9:00 to 19:00. On Wednesday and Saturday mornings this is the site of the country market, which also sets up shop in the neighbouring pedestrian streets. Every first Friday of the month, it plays host to a craft market. Typical cafes, boutiques and large, elegant shops complement what this high-class district, which is completely pedestrianised, has to offer.

This former Bel-Air church transformed into a cultural centre welcomes an eclectic audience since 2004. A small, intimist theatre, it hosts politically active and educational plays, comedians as well as dance performances by Lausanne companies.

The Centre Culturel des Terreaux offers a varied programme all year round. Theatrical performances, dance or comedy shows, concerts and much more – you’re sure to find something to your liking among the twenty-odd events organised in this former church. Drama classes for adults, seniors or teenagers are also held there.
